Output 08eec875288e6fe764afc181a1236d13419bcf4d8eb74f86c968285bb9eef224:1

value
71113023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8661284bf3b02842ae9cf42b31fc11c72ea45e02 OP_EQUAL
address
3DwYrs5FVynNJJSJ9fNzDiUHEFwoRQu8VW
transaction
08eec875288e6fe764afc181a1236d13419bcf4d8eb74f86c968285bb9eef224
spent
true